Transaction 39e8912e7c75b30bf928e27e34507fcf111f85b5d8808d9df98fde72623c1596
1 Input
1 Output
-
39e8912e7c75b30bf928e27e34507fcf111f85b5d8808d9df98fde72623c1596:0
- value
- 510808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47c8f59e86a3aa95f7bb761dd14d9a3a029f4528 OP_EQUAL
- address
- 38Eae55RaCuxrBdodi2STF9qeBp9E9e2r2